So you need to upgrade Quillpipe, our message broker. Good news: it's mostly painless if you follow the order — drain consumers first, snapshot the offsets, then roll brokers one at a time. Bad news: skip the offset snapshot and you'll replay a week of events (this has happened, we don't talk about March). Minor versions are safe to roll live; majors need a maintenance window. The full upgrade checklist and rollback steps live on the internal page below.

dashboard of tawef-hagug = https://superset.norvadyn.local/display/projects/build/ticket/build/spaces/ticket/1e989f0e6c200d20fc4ae06b

## Add snapshot tests for Quillhaven UI components

This PR adds snapshot coverage for the checkout banner, toast, and modal components the support team screenshots most often. Snapshots regenerate in CI on approved visual changes, so diffs in tickets should match what customers see. Flaky renders are retried before failing. The thresholds used by the snapshot runner are listed below.

tuning table, yajog-yahof:
BUDGETS = {
    "lamvan": 303,
    "wenox": 460,
    "fenvan": 525,
}

Handover for the eng sync: the Lumenkart consent banner is live on 40% of traffic. Remaining work is the preference-center deep link and the stale-cookie cleanup job, both tracked in the rollout board. No open incidents; opt-out rates match projections. I'm rotating off the project at the end of this sprint. Going forward, questions and escalations should go to the new owner named below.

account owner for fajep-yagef: Kasix Eliiel

**First-day checklist — Reception, Bramleigh House**

☐ Show the new starter the evacuation-chair store on the mezzanine landing, next to the east stairwell. Confirm they know the chair is for assisting mobility-impaired visitors during an evacuation and must never be moved for any other reason. Walk them through the quick-release strap and point out the laminated instruction card on the inside of the door. The store is kept locked at all times, and the keypad uses the standard reception access code.

turnstile pass: bdg-NG-3